Fullerians vs. Bedford
A game of two halves as Blues continue the unbeaten run!
This really was a game of two halves, first half we were down 15-19 and 2nd half we won the game 39-19. First match after Xmas and the backs were still wearing their cracker hats and munching on turkey legs by the time Fullers had run in three tries. To say we were disorganised in the backs is being polite, so many times our centres were being pulled out of position and allowed Fullers to exploit these holes with some strong offloads to their second rows. More on the backs later, now to the forwards, brilliant first half!!
The next couple of lines will sound more like a garden centre catalogue than a match report but our forwards produced pod after pod. Fadds 'rose' time after time to win many line-outs regardless of who was throwing in. The support play from our collection of little flowers was excellent with players ‘sprouting’ up all over the park, well done.
We moved into the second half with a couple of positional changes (Steph moved to my right shoulder) and the backs determined to not let the forwards grab all the headlines. What a difference, the tiring forwards were happy to let 9 ship the ball out and many a flash ball found the centres and out to the wing with much ground being made, a massive turnaround from the first half!
This was a competitive match and Fullerians were good opposition with a well drilled set of backs that put us under a lot of pressure. However, this is a great squad of boys and you are starting to trust each other and support each other at pace and with the right amount of aggression, not to mention your great fitness, all that work has paid off!
Not the prettiest of games but the unbeaten run goes on, well done!
